LinPark 01-02-2014 11:40 AM

Yeah, a random orbital polisher. Had no idea it had enough cutting power to do that but it was right on an edge. I had an issue on that fender a few months back and I think the guy who fixed it actually did some wet sanding there. So my guess is that it already had next to no clearcoat right there and I just pushed it over the edge.
